Stream 'Shark Week' 2026's 'Air Jaws: Red, White and Breach' Special

Africa16 hr ago

Viewers can watch the 'Air Jaws: Red, White and Breach' special online as part of Discovery Channel's 'Shark Week' 2026 programming. The documentary features filmmakers Jeff Kurr, Alison Towner, and Andy Casagrande. Their objective is to capture footage of great white sharks breaching the water's surface. This particular installment of 'Air Jaws' focuses on the dramatic behavior of these apex predators. The special promises to showcase the thrilling and often unpredictable nature of shark interactions with their environment. It aims to provide an up-close look at the hunting techniques of great white sharks. The production team will be utilizing advanced filming techniques to document these events. The broadcast is part of the annual 'Shark Week' event, known for its in-depth exploration of shark behavior and conservation efforts. This year's 'Air Jaws' special is expected to draw significant viewership due to the popularity of the franchise and the captivating subject matter.
